Cape Town has a history stretching back to the early 1650’s when Jan van Riebeek arrived and set up the first European outpost in South Africa at the Cape of Good Hope. Soon the city outgrew its hub at the Castle of Good Hope and has been growing and evolving ever since.

Today Cape Town is one of the most culturally diverse and strikingly scenic cities in the world. The city can be roughly divided into 8 sections, each with its own character. This mixture of neighbourhoods ensures that where accommodation is concerned, there is something for everyone.

The city centre is known as the city bowl, for being encircled on three sides by the famous Table Mountain, now a World Heritage Site. This flat-topped mountain is unique in its shape and provides one of the most memorable backdrops of any city anywhere. A visit to Cape Town would not be complete without a hike or cable car ride up to the top, from where you can look out over the city below, the bay and Robben Island and see as far as the mountain ranges which form the boundary of the Cape Winelands.

The city centre is where most of Cape Town’s creative energy is concentrated, and milling around areas like Kloof and Bree Street will have you rubbing shoulders with the creative elite as well as coming face to face with some of the city’s best bars and restaurants. To the west, the Atlantic Seaboard, which includes suburbs like Sea Point and Greenpoint, puts you in sight of the vast Atlantic Ocean and the promenade makes a great place for an early morning jog or stroll.

Further south, the little fishing villages of Kalk Bay and Simon’s Town are backed by the spine of the mountain and have a distinctly bohemian air about them. Little coffee shops and seaside restaurants are interspersed with little art galleries and shops selling gypsy-like wares.

Travelling northwards, the suburbs on the west coast have a more arid landscape which comes with long stretches of sandy beach.

Cape Town is full of things to do and places to see, so make sure you give yourself enough time to experience it all!
